Brunch in the RGV

Among our favorite things to do on the weekends besides unwinding and relaxing is brunch. We are especially excited that more delicious options are constantly emerging in the Rio Grande Valley.


For my husband and I, brunch is our most unhurried meal of the week. We are constantly looking for places with savory dishes that can be paired with a delicious drink or two. Brunch, which is a combination of breakfast and lunch, is usually eaten late in the morning or early in the afternoon. A typical brunch combines classic foods like french toast, pancakes or waffles with rich egg dishes. Although we are always trying new dishes, our absolute favorite is eggs benedict. We get so excited when we find places that add their own twist to our favored brunch dish.


With this said, here are some of our favorite spots to enjoy brunch in the RGV. We will update this list as we come across more spots to share.


 

La Casa de La Abuela - McAllen, Texas


This was our first time trying La Casa de la Abuela in McAllen! If you’ve never been here, here’s what we had to help you order:


* Croissant con huevos benedictinos (their take on eggs benedict)

* Migas a la Mexicana

* Cafes lecheros


This restaurant was really cute and classy! We loved everything about it and service was great.


 

On the Grill Restaurant - Pharr, Texas


Brunch for 2 in the Rio Grande Valley for less than $20!


On The Grill Restaurant in Pharr has a great and affordable brunch menu and $2 mimosas!


Here’s what we ordered:

* Huevos Molcajete

*Migas a la Mexicana

* Short Stack of Pancakes
